Transaction 63a476ccf35c8217ce4d580a5bbd3e112ac4cf08c5705b75f019556e09c8feab

3 Input
2 Outputs
  • 63a476ccf35c8217ce4d580a5bbd3e112ac4cf08c5705b75f019556e09c8feab:0
  • value  614046
    address  17g8wvg3fiNN7yk3fvG5aksW3pX5b64b3T
  • 63a476ccf35c8217ce4d580a5bbd3e112ac4cf08c5705b75f019556e09c8feab:1
  • value  3316
    address  bc1qx68uywkl4vtrhwk27h8s967juqzg4s4yw0mj8d